Understanding Performance Anxiety in Dance

Performance anxiety in dance is a form of social anxiety that specifically affects dancers when performing in front of an audience. It often manifests as a fear of judgment, insecurity, and self-doubt. This anxiety can have a significant impact on the quality of a dancer's performance and overall well-being.

Impacts on Physical and Mental Health in Dance

The physical manifestations of performance anxiety can lead to increased muscle tension, decreased flexibility, and impaired coordination, negatively impacting a dancer's ability to perform at their best. Mentally, performance anxiety can lead to decreased confidence, impaired concentration, and even depression or other mental health issues.

Role of Dance Therapy

Dance therapy is a therapeutic approach that uses movement and dance to support intellectual, emotional, and motor functions in individuals. It provides a safe space for self-expression, exploration of emotions, and the development of coping strategies. Additionally, dance therapy can help improve body awareness, reduce stress, and enhance overall well-being.

Integration into Treatment

Integrating dance therapy into the treatment of performance anxiety in dancers involves incorporating it as part of a comprehensive treatment plan. This may include individual or group therapy sessions, where dancers can explore their emotions, practice self-care, and build resilience through movement and dance.

Benefits of Integration

By integrating dance therapy into the treatment of performance anxiety, dancers can experience a range of benefits. These include improved self-confidence, enhanced performance quality, better stress management, and an overall improvement in physical and mental health.
